Beginning this year, our preschool program is led by three experienced Lead Teachers, bringing a new level of consistency and care to our classrooms. Each of our two preschool rooms is led by its own dedicated Lead Teacher, supported by an Instructional Assistant, while a third floating Lead Teacher provides support, enrichment, and flexibility across both rooms.
With this model, we offer a 1:6 teacher-to-student ratio, ensuring every child receives individualized attention and care as they grow.
Flexible Scheduling for Families
Our preschool classrooms include a diverse mix of scheduling options to meet families’ needs:
- 2-day (T/TH): Half-day or full-day
- 3-day (MWF): Half-day or full-day
- 5-day: Half-day or full-day
This flexible design gives families the ability to build a schedule that fits their lifestyle, while still allowing students to build strong peer relationships and settle into a consistent routine. Each preschool classroom is a mix of students from our 2, 3, and 5 day options.
Inquiry-Based Learning
At the heart of our EC programs is a commitment to inquiry-based learning. Our teachers observe, listen, and document students’ interests to build thematic units around what naturally excites them. Whether it's trains, pizza, farm animals, or nature - learning at St. James begins with curiosity.
We also recognize that no two children grow and develop the same way or on the same timeline. Our educators support each child’s unique learning journey through purposeful play, hands-on exploration, and nurturing relationships.
